Lavinia, Nico of 'Bituing Walang Ningning' return in musical

Cris Villongco and Mark Bautista will play two of the key roles in the theater adaptation of the film “Bituing Walang Ningning.” Facebook/Hari ng Tondo Facebook Page| Philstar.com/Joyce Jimenez

MANILA, Philippines - Cris Villongco and Mark Bautista will play two of the lead roles in the theater adaptation of the 1985 film “Bituing Walang Ningning.”

They will play the roles of Lavinia and Nico, which were first portrayed by Cherie Gil and Christopher de Leon in the original film.

“Since I’m given a chance to play kontra-bida roles now, I will milk it and I will do my best,” said Villongco in an interview with Nelson Canlas, aired in “24 Oras” on Thursday. She’s currently portraying a villain role in GMA’s drama series “Ang Lihim ni Annasandra.”

On the other hand, Bautista is both excited and nervous about doing the musical.

“May mga songs na kailangan kong pag-aralan talaga, ibang technique. So may mga gano’ng training talagang ginawa ako,” he said.

As for the role of Sharon Cuneta as Dorina, an audition for the said role will happen on February 28 to March 3, at the Resorts World Manila and is open for both veteran and amateur theater performer, ages sixteen to twenty years old.

“Bituing Walang Ningning” is a story about a fan, Dorina, who was belittled by her idol Lavinia. Yet eventually the tables were turned as Lavinia lost her stardom and was taken over by her former fan Dorina.
